"Ice Age" takes over the Natural History Museum: Poles exhibit and two-day "Ice Festival" open

Regional Museum of Natural History - Plovdiv invites residents and guests of the city to the official opening of the new exhibition "Poles", created under the project "Construction of a living exhibition Antarctica", financed by the National Fund "Culture", accompanied by the holding of the first of its kind "Ice festival " (February 16 and 17, 2024).

The opening of the new "Poles" exhibition and the two-day festival is on Friday, February 16, at 10:00 a.m. in the museum lobby. It will be attended by the Children's Music and Dance Formation at the Little Prince School, Plovdiv, which will present to the audience "Dance of the Ice Octopuses" and "Ocean Orchestra".

Guests at the opening will be the Mayor of Plovdiv Kostadin Dimitrov and the Deputy Mayor for Culture, Archeology and Tourism Plamen Panov.

The program of the "Ice Festival" on Friday, February 16, continues from 10:30 a.m. until 3:00 p.m. with a creative workshop in which children will assemble educational puzzles that will introduce them to the diverse world of marine fauna.

From 1:30 p.m. until 4:30 p.m. on the same day there will be a "Water Adventure" where children will have the opportunity to transform into their favorite aquatic creatures through artistic face painting.

On Saturday, February 17, from 10:00 a.m. until 3:00 p.m. "Antarctic Wonders" coloring workshop will be held. In it, young visitors will immerse themselves in the world of Antarctic animals through drawing, which will not only develop their artistic skills, but also stimulate their understanding of the importance of preserving nature.

The project "Building a living exhibit Antarctica" aims to upgrade the capacity of the museum by building the first in Europe exhibition of live specimens, rare species of fish and invertebrates from the Antarctic continent. The project is innovative and includes several stages - construction of an exposition, delivery of live specimens of the Bulgarian polar scientists from Antarctica, holding a Festival, creation of specific content for the exposition and work with target audiences. The project partner is the Bulgarian Antarctic Institute.
